A leading Payment Aggregator and provider of secure payment solutions is looking for an Intermediate Developer to join their growing team in Stellenbosch.
This will be a hybrid role. Responsibilities will include:
Technical integration of new clients into systems
Development testing
Fixes & maintenance on current system
Enhancements of current functionality
New functionality design & development
Query resolution (3rd line support)
System Security & Audits
Improve development techniques and processes
Required Technical Skills and Experience:
Tertiary or equivalent training in software development, computer science or engineering
3-5 years relevant development experience
Java, both Standard and Enterprise Editions, Spring Boot
SQL (MS SQL Server / Postgres)
Development workflow: Eclipse / Netbeans IDEs, Maven, GIT
Working in a continuous integration and testing environment
OpenAPI protocols
Advantageous Technical Skills and Experience:
Exposure to financial transaction processing systems and multi-threaded, high volume real-time systems
Postilion development skills (source / sink node development)
Exposure and participation in Agile methods like Scrum / Kanban
Experience in front-end development using the Angular framework
Seniority level: Mid-Senior level
Employment type: Full-time
Job function: Engineering and Information Technology